The housing crisis is one of the most pressing global challenges. Every day, 1 in 3 people on the planet wake up without access to a safe, affordable home.

Habitat for Humanity of Wicomico County (HFHWC) joins hundreds of Habitat organizations worldwide to launch Let’s Open the Door, a new global campaign taking place in Habitat’s 50th anniversary year and bringing this urgency forward through pop-up installations, on-the-ground builds, and digital storytelling across more than 60 countries.

This coordinated effort is designed to help ignite a global movement around an issue shaping health, equity, and economic resilience.

In Wicomico County, 31.6% of households are cost-burdened, meaning nearly one in three families spend more than 30% of their income on housing—often forcing difficult choices between rent, food, healthcare, and transportation.

“There is a lack of supply for every income level,” said Hilligoss. “And one thing that people aren’t talking about is the preservation of existing homes that we already have. The three biggest home improvement requests we receive are a new roof, a new HVAC system, and a walk-in shower for mobility and safety access,” Hilligoss said. “Those are the basics, but they are also expensive. About Habitat for Humanity of Wicomico County

Habitat for Humanity works to make homeownership of safe, affordable homes a matter of conscience and action. Habitat for Humanity of Wicomico County was founded in 1987. Since then, the affiliate has served 94 families with affordable homeownership and 150 families with critical home repairs. For more information, visit www.wicomicohabitat.org.
